Outils pour utilisateurs

Outils du site


software:applications:ls

La commande ls

La CLI ls permet de lister le contenu des répertoires du système de fichiers.

Lister seulement les répertoires

Pour lister seulement les répertoires :

ls -ld */

A propos des paramètres utilisés ici, l'option -l permet d' afficher le résultat sous forme de liste (un élément par ligne).

C'est la combinaison des paramètres -d */ qui permet de n'afficher que les répertoires. Si la commande ls est invoquée seulement avec l'argument -d c'est le nom du répertoire courant qui est retourné (-d retourne le nom des répertoires par leur contenu). L'argument * sélectionne tout le contenu du répertoire courant (fichiers et dossiers) et / permet de restreindre le motif aux répertoires.

D'autres commandes permettent d'arriver au même résultat :

echo */
 
# Recherche et affiche les répertoires du répertoire courant
find . -maxdepth 1 -type d
 
# Avec la commande tree
tree -d -L 1

Références

software/applications/ls.txt · Dernière modification : 2024/04/17 09:06 de yoann